Building for the Future - Dell Children's Third Bed Tower Project
When Dell Children's Medical Center opened in the summer of 2007, a whole new world of possibilities opened as well. Our hospital is one of the most innovative, family-centered and eco-friendly pediatric hospitals in the world.
Announcing Dell Children's Phase II
Since opening, Dell Children's has increased patient visits by over 63%. Last year alone, the hospital had over 137,000 patient visits. Adding an additional patient bed tower has been part of the long-term plan for Dell Children's. The time is now and the children of Central Texas need us to be ready. This expansion will help Dell Children's keep pace with the growth in our region, respond to rising patient volumes, and provide additional space for patient care. Construction begins this fall and doors will open for patients in summer 2013.
Impact of the Third Bed Tower Includes: - Increased bed capacity to 248 beds, adding 72 new beds - Increased critical care capacity for all medical programs Added and expanded medical programs, such as: - Inpatient Rehabilitation - Cardiology - Orthopedics and Sports Medicine - Neurosciences, including an expanded Epilepsy Monitoring Unit - Surgical Intensive Care Unit
